Mancer: Weaver (alpha)

Mancer Weaver (alpha) is a text-focused AI model capable of processing up to 8,000 tokens of context and generating up to 2,000 completion tokens. Unlike some models, Mancer Weaver does not support tools, reasoning, or structured output. Its primary strength lies in handling text-based inputs, making it suitable for tasks that require understanding and generating natural language responses. Given its current lack of benchmark coverage, users should consider Mancer Weaver if they are primarily working with text data and can accept the model's limitations in terms of tools and reasoning support. With pricing at $0.5 per million input tokens and $0.75 per million output tokens, it may be cost-effective for projects that involve extensive text processing but need to avoid complex operations or structured outputs.
